McDermott slips into bankruptcy with CLOs holding almost $1 billion
5 years ago
42 CLO managers hold $957.6 million of the debt of McDermott International, which fil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y on Tuesday. Under the plan, McDermott’s term loan and revolving lenders will receive 94% of McDermott’s reorganised equity and $500 million in take back senior secured term loans. Term loan claims are expected to recover 84%, according to a disclosure statement -
